2. gt a 74 E A bike stand is required and will make the whole job safer and easier Just be sure the bike is stable ALWAYS Remember Safety First bikeleftside360 JPG First you need to drain the oil Place a container under the engine oil drain bolt Remove the engine oil fill cap and O ring Remove the engine oil drain bolt amp gasket Let the oil drain completely Oil Drain Bolt 17mmB be eco friendly recycle oildrain360 jpg Page 3 of 23 flbd_shifter360 jpg shifterclamp360 jpg Remove the following from the left side of the bike floorboard and shifter 2 14mmS shifter linkage 10mmB Note The shifter linkage shaft has a small indentation on it Be sure to get a good look how it aligns with the gap in the clamp Page 4 of 23 Remove the following from the left side Drive train cover 4 SmmH Clutch Linkage Cover 3 5SmmH Kick Stand Bolts 2 14mmS Be careful the kickstand sensor switch wire is very short Disconnect the clutch cable by grabbing the lever with a pair of pliers rotate counter clockwise until you can remove the cable end from the bracket cableClutch1360 jpg Page 5 of 23 tywrap360 jpg Disconnect the stator and speed sensor connectors Remove the Left crankcase cover Crankcase Cover Bolts 14 SmmH There are different length bolts used so you may want to number them as shown this will make it easier to re install them Note when you

Changing The V Star 1100 Stator written by Dragonbird Norwestars ISRA This is my personnel attempt to document changing out the stator on a Yamaha V Star 1100 This should be used as a guide only I assume NO responsibility for any mistakes When in doubt refer to the manual The bike I used is my own 2002 V Star 1100 A lot of the info is per the Yamaha Service manual Be sure to check the manual for your particular bike Here s what I tried to maintain Cautionary notes in bolded RED note and mark the alignment Torque values in bolded BLUE 7 2 ft lb 86 4 inlb Quantity of bolts nuts or screws 3 Wrench sizes in bolded GREEN 10mmxX the x S socket B boxed end H hex Personal comments in italics Safety First Actions to perform in normal text Have fun and ride Items Needed New Left crankcase cover gasket 4 qts Crankcase Oil and filter Stator amp Rectifier Replacement Tools Needed Torque Wrench 4mm hex driver tip Smm hex driver tip 10mm socket 14mm socket 10mm boxed end wrench 17mm socket oil drain plug a wrench may be used Threadlocker blue Locktite 242 When re assembling be sure to use the threadlocker Page 1 of 23 Here are both the old stator Left and the new stator Right bothstators jpg Page 2 of 23 Se Ea Pe i 4 S ae For removal of the Stator you will need access to the LEFT side of the E N i bike i pi i jag 8 1 i __4

H cover jpg Remove the rectifier There are 2 fiber washers that go behind the regulator rectifier bolts 2 XmmS regulator 2 jpg Page 18 of 23 Unplug the cable by pressing on the tab and pulling re gulator 3 l jpg Old rectifier bolts and fiber washers regulator 5 jpg Page 19 of 23 New rectifier bolts and fiber washers Attach the cable to the New rectifier and install on the housing Torque Rectifier bolts 2 Snug xx ft lb NOTE I can t find the torque spec for the regulator bolts the bolts go into a metal clip which isn t very strong so just make the bolts snug Re Install the rectifier cover Torque cover bolts 1 10mmH 5 1 ft lb With the lower exhaust pipe removed at this point you may want to change the oil filter or install an oil filter relocation kit Re Install the exhaust pipe system Stock Torque Pipe and Muffler bolts 2 10mmH 14 ft lb Torque Muffler Bracket Bolts 2 xxmmH 18 ft lb Torque Engine Exhaust Nuts 2 xxmmsS 14 ft lb Re Install the Master Cylinder and Floorboard Torque Master Cylinder Bolts 2 10mmH 17 ft Ib Torque Floorboard Bolts 2 14mmS 46 ft lb Page 20 of 23 Now let s test it With the engine OFF Measure the voltage DC across the battery It should read about 12 4 12 9 volts Start the bike Measure the voltage across the battery but this time rev the engine The voltage should be between 14 1 and 14 9 volts
7. r connector and the new speed sensor connectors Pull protective boot down over the connectors and re attach note your cables should be about 4 5 inches long than shown This photo was taken using the prototype which had shorter wires At this point you can start the engine and make sure everything works Do not run for more than a few seconds remember no oil yet IF THE ENGINE IS ROUGH RUNNING OR BACKFIRES SWAP THE GREEN AND BLUE WIRES FROM THE PICKUP COIL Page 12 of 23 Re install the following on the LEFT side of the bike clutch cable clutch adjusting cover 3 Torque the bolts 5mmH 7 2 ft lb 86 4 inlb Drive train Cover 4 5mmH 5 1 ft lb 61 2 inlb kickstand 2 Torque the bolts 14mmS 46 ft lb Kickstand360 JPG Also install the following on the LEFT side of the bike shifter linkage note the alignment Torque the bolt 10mmB 7 2 ft lb 86 4 inIb floorboard w shifter 2 Torque the bolts 14mmS 46 ft lb flbd_shifter360 jpg Page 13 of 23 Verify installed or install the engine oil drain bolt and gasket Torque the bolt 17mmS 31 ft lb oildrain360 jpg Fill the crankcase with oil Without filter replacement approx 3 2 US qts With filter replacement std filter approx 3 3 US qts With relocation filter replacement approx 4 3 US qts Be sure to check the engine oil level as your filling the crankcase Page 14 of 23 Ok now let s Rectifier Regulator
8. remove the engine side cover some oil will drain out so be sure to use a drip pan or put down some plastic sheeting When the cover is removed you may find the wires ty wrapped Carefully cut the ty wrap Page 6 of 23 amp starterGears1360 jpg Once the cover is removed take a look at the starter gears Note here in the top photo the gears have slipped out of place If this happens and it probably will you will need to move them back in place then push the center pin back in It s kind of tricky but you can do it Basically push the gears UP while pushing the pin in also turning the flywheel clockwise will help a lot Top photo show the gears dropped the bottom photo shows them in place When the gears are in their proper place the center pin sticks out about 1 2 inch 0 480 Page 7 of 23 amp Look at the inside of the left cover plate Look at the hole that the shifter shaft goes thru There is a washer that goes here If the washer is stuck to the cover remove it a put it on the shifter shaft E washer1360 jpg Page 8 of 23 statorbolts3 60 jpg This is the inside of the left cover Note the location of the Guide Pins These may be either in the cover or still on the engine If possible put them both into the appropriate holes on the engine They can be loose so don t lose them The stator is that thing in the middle Above the stator is the pickup coil Now remove the 6 bolt
9. s indicated There are 3 on the stator 2 on the speed sensor and 1 on the bracket Stator bolts 5mmH Pickup Coil bolts 4mmH Bracket bolt 4mmH Once the bolts are removed lift out the stator and pickup coil Note that the pickup coil may need a little persuasion to get it free Page 9 of 23 P intialinstall jpg Clean off any remaining gasket material from both the engine and the cover Be careful not the scratch the surfaces Also be sure to clean the gasket surfaces thoroughly when your done removing the old gasket material Install the new stator into the left engine cover Put the 2 wires BEHIND the post shown at arrow put the smaller of the 2 wire down first then the larger one Stator bolts 3 5mmH 7 2 ft lb 86 4 inlb Pickup Coil bolts 2 4mmH 5 1 ft lb 61 2 inlb Be sure to run the stator wires as shown The rubber grommets should be positioned so the flat edge is face up Page 10 of 23 Now install the bracket Be careful not to pinch the wires Bracket bolt 1 4mmH 5 1 ft lb 61 2 inlb Put the NEW crankcase cover gasket in place on the engine Page 11 of 23 alternatorcover360 jpg starorwines3 60 jpg Install the Left crankcase cover Torque the bolts 14 5mmH 7 2 ft lb 86 4 inlb Be sure to torque the bolts evenly I typically use the same method as when you replace a car tire Do one bolt then the opposite bolt going in a clockwise direction Connect the new stato
